Transaction 2475ced86e11aee42a176680f96e360ef89855133310e1d424f1df035fb8e40a
1 Input
2 Outputs
- 2475ced86e11aee42a176680f96e360ef89855133310e1d424f1df035fb8e40a:0
- 2475ced86e11aee42a176680f96e360ef89855133310e1d424f1df035fb8e40a:1
value 3094751676
address 1GQdrgqAbkeEPUef1UpiTc4X1mUHMcyuGW
value 1203313
address 1EjK3BzvWs98B2CN5qNvHnBbfu2vAxgfum